System and method for smart grid dynamic regulation pools
Abstract:
A system and method is provided for smart grid dynamic regulation pools. The system may include at least one processor configured to initiate a plurality of pool regulation tasks that are respectively executed by different processing resources. The pool regulation tasks respectively manage respective subsets of electrical power assets assigned to respective different regulation pools to fulfill electrical power requirements for market orders received from at least one energy trading market system. Such management may include determining whether to reassign at least one asset to fulfill at least one market order. Also responsive to a determination to reassign the at least one asset, the management may include removing the at least one asset from one regulation pool managed with one pool regulation task for at least one market order and assigning the removed asset to another regulation pool managed with another pool regulation task for at least one market order.
